Applications of SL82% Reinforcing Mesh


SL82% reinforcing mesh is extensively used in a variety of construction applications, including


1. Concrete Slabs It is commonly used in floor slabs for residential and commercial structures, where it helps to distribute loads evenly and minimizes the risk of cracks.


2. Roads and Pavements The mesh is employed in roadways to enhance load-bearing capacity and extend the lifespan of asphalt and concrete pavements.


3. Walls and Foundations In foundation work, SL82% reinforcing mesh provides significant tensile strength, ensuring stability and resistance against shifting or settling over time.

4. Precast Concrete It is also integral to precast concrete products, giving them the necessary reinforcement to withstand stresses during transport and installation.


Benefits of Using SL82% Reinforcing Mesh


1. Enhanced Strength and Durability The primary advantage of SL82% reinforcing mesh is its ability to significantly improve the tensile strength of concrete. This reinforcement helps prevent cracking and collapsing under stress.


2. Cost-Effectiveness By reducing the risk of structural failure and extending the lifespan of concrete installations, SL82% mesh can ultimately lead to cost savings in maintenance and repairs.


3. Ease of Installation The prefabricated nature of reinforcing mesh allows for quick and straightforward installation, which can save time on the job site.


4. Versatility It can be used in a variety of construction projects, making it a flexible option for contractors dealing with multiple building designs and requirements.


5. Sustainability Utilizing steel for reinforcement contributes to sustainability goals, as steel is a recyclable material, and using mesh can minimize the need for additional concrete.
